News summary

Boston Celtics guard Derrick White was involved in a physical altercation during the Colorado vs. Colorado State football game in Fort Collins. A video posted by TMZ shows White, who was there to support his alma mater, being struck in the head by a fan, which knocked his hat off. The incident began as a verbal spat and escalated into a brief scuffle involving multiple fans. Law enforcement intervened to de-escalate the situation, and no police report was filed. Despite the altercation, White was uninjured and played a peacemaking role during the brawl. The game ended with Colorado defeating Colorado State 28-9.
